The Federal Government has raised $2.2 billion in Eurobonds to fund the fiscal deficit in the 2024 budget. According to a statement by the Debt Management Office (DMO), the bonds will mature in the international capital markets in 2031 (6.5-year) and 2034 (10-year). President Bola Tinubu has directed the Federal Ministry of Justice to work with the National Assembly to ensure that “genuine concerns” associated with the Tax Reform Bills are addressed before they are passed by lawmakers. Akpooh Edet, a 35-year-old suspect, has been apprehended by security operatives for staging his own abduction and demanding a ransom fee of N50 million from his boss. The male suspect works as a security guard at Rubber Estate in Ose River, Ovia South West Local Government area of Edo State. The police detective in Nyahururu has intercepted and seized 22,000 litres of ethanol moved from Malaba border towards Nairobi, the capital of Kenya. Through the Directorate of Criminal Investigation-Kenya (DCI) disclosure on their X page on Tuesday, it was revealed that two suspects, Victor Kitavi, the driver, and Dickson Wandera, were arrested after an attempt to flee the scene. The police command in Ekiti State has confirmed the arrest of Dele Farotimi, a human rights advocate. According to TheCable, Sunday Abutu, the police spokesperson in Ekiti, said operatives arrested Farotimi over a petition about alleged defamation and cyberbullying. Abutu said the command obtained a warrant of arrest against Farotimi regarding the case, adding that the activist is currently being transported from Lagos to Ekiti State. Nine persons have been reported killed by bandits in Sokoto State, Northwest, Nigeria. According to SaharaReporters, the terrorists stormed Dantudu Lajinge village in the Sabon Birni Local Government Area and slit the throat of nine persons identified as members of the community’s local security outfit, known as vigilante. The House of Representatives has asked President Bola Tinubu to mandate Minister of Finance, Wale Edun to unfreeze all National Social Investment Programmes Agency (NSIPA) accounts within 72 hours. The lower legislative chamber passed the resolution during plenary on Tuesday. This was sequel to the adoption of a motion sponsored by Benjamin Kalu, deputy speaker, and 20 other lawmakers. An Ikeja Special Offences Court on Tuesday has admitted as evidence an iPhone belonging to social media celebrity, Ismaila Mustapha, popularly known as Mompha, in an ongoing ₦6 billion money laundering case.
